Output 90d3a924bd7268177575ed2458d156524042de13ebfaa6e9964f7b1ed9d722a7:1

value
32563700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1658570c695a685fc89caf44842de697bebf3c71 OP_EQUAL
address
33jAcjhxnuBDqzYbYHtobW1Bvm1qKrekFT
transaction
90d3a924bd7268177575ed2458d156524042de13ebfaa6e9964f7b1ed9d722a7
confirmations
436191
spent
true